What should I remodel first?
If you need to choose which room to remodel first, you'll want to choose the room that will recoup the remodeling costs and create actual equity. This is why experts agree that choosing to remodel your kitchen or bathroom first is traditionally the smartest move.

What is the most expensive part of a bathroom remodel?
In general, two of the most expensive parts of a bathroom remodel are moving a waste line and replacing a vanity, Huebner says. If you change the bathroom's layout, that involves moving the toilet, sink, or tub and needs the help Additional reading of a professional plumber. Expect to pay about $45 to $65 per hour in labor.

What remodel adds the most value?
Here are the six home remodeling projects that deliver the highest returns. 1. Manufactured stone veneer. Average cost: $9,357.
2. Garage door replacement. Average cost: $3,695.
3. Minor kitchen remodel. Average cost: $23,452.
4. Siding replacement (fiber-cement) Average cost: $17,008.
5. Siding replacement (vinyl)
6. Window replacement (vinyl)
